Highlights
  • Piazza Maggiore - We will discover the secrets and the great masterpieces of the square, such as the terracotta works of Nicolo’ dell’Arca, the Fountain of Neptune, Palazzo Comunale and San Petronio.
    We will visit some splendid frescoed rooms of the Palazzo Comunale, the grand staircase of Bramane’s horses and other small jewels of the sumptuous…
